[K-POP] The Ultimate Party Starter: Lee Chan-won Set to Ignite the 'Nora BOEUN' Youth Festival!

K-POP Real News Scene

A Star Who Knows How to Party: Lee Chan-won’s Rising Influence

In the vibrant landscape of the South Korean music scene, few artists possess the innate ability to bridge the gap between generations quite like Lee Chan-won. Known affectionately as a 'young man who knows how to have a good time,' Lee has consistently proven that his charisma transcends the traditional boundaries of Trot music. His latest headline-grabbing announcement—his upcoming appearance at the Boeun Youth Festival, aptly titled 'Nora BOEUN (Play BOEUN)'—has sent waves of excitement through his massive fanbase, known as Chan-s. This festival isn't just another performance; it is a celebration of youthful spirit, and having Lee Chan-won as the headliner is the perfect synergy of talent and energy.

The Evolution of a Musical Powerhouse

Lee Chan-won’s rise to stardom has been nothing short of spectacular. Since his breakthrough on Mr. Trot, he has evolved from a gifted newcomer into a household name and a beloved variety show fixture. Unlike many idols who stick to one lane, Lee has mastered the art of being a multi-hyphenate talent—he is a singer, a witty TV host, and an entertainer who genuinely cares about his fans. His ability to maintain his roots in Trot while embracing the high-energy demands of modern youth festivals showcases his versatility. Whether he is belting out a classic ballad or engaging in hilarious banter, Lee keeps the audience hooked, proving exactly why he remains a top-tier performer in the competitive K-content industry.
